When I first start my van. It sputters for a good while ...than when driving. It sputters when at idle. And also. When I going between forty and 60 miles per hour. And I slightly push gas pedal. Feels like the engine jerks or studders.

Your van's sputtering at start, idle, and while driving could point to several potential issues. A common culprit is a problem with the ignition system, such as worn-out spark plugs, bad spark plug wires, or a failing ignition coil. These can cause misfires, leading to sputtering and hesitation. Another possibility is a fuel delivery issue, such as a dirty fuel injector, low fuel pressure, or a failing fuel pump. Additionally, a dirty or faulty idle air control (IAC) valve or mass airflow (MAF) sensor could disrupt the air-fuel mixture, causing sputtering. These issues can be challenging to diagnose, so it may be best to consult a trusted repair shop for a diagnosis.
